Genesis, 35

f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
And God saith unto Jacob, `Rise, go up to Bethel, and dwell there, and make there an altar to God, who appeared unto thee in thy fleeing from the face of Esau thy brother.'  
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
And Jacob saith unto his household, and unto all who `are' with him, `Turn aside the gods of the stranger which `are' in your midst, and cleanse yourselves, and change your garments; 
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
and we rise, and go up to Bethel, and I make there an altar to God, who is answering me in the day of my distress, and is with me in the way that I have gone.'  
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
And they give unto Jacob all the gods of the stranger that `are' in their hand, and the rings that `are' in their ears, and Jacob hideth them under the oak which `is' by Shechem; 
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
and they journey, and the terror of God is on the cities which `are' round about them, and they have not pursued after the sons of Jacob. 
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
And Jacob cometh in to Luz which `is' in the land of Canaan (it `is' Bethel), he and all the people who `are' with him, 
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
and he buildeth there an altar, and proclaimeth at the place the God of Bethel: for there had God been revealed unto him, in his fleeing from the face of his brother.  
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
And Deborah, Rebekah's nurse, dieth, and she is buried at the lower part of Bethel, under the oak, and he calleth its name `Oak of weeping.'  
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
And God appeareth unto Jacob again, in his coming from Padan-Aram, and blesseth him;  
10 
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
and God saith to him, `Thy name `is' Jacob: thy name is no more called Jacob, but Israel is thy name;' and He calleth his name Israel. 
11 
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
And God saith to him, `I `am' God Almighty; be fruitful and multiply, a nation and an assembly of nations is from thee, and kings from thy loins go out; 
12 
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
and the land which I have given to Abraham and to Isaac -- to thee I give it, yea to thy seed after thee I give the land.'  
13 
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
And God goeth up from him, in the place where He hath spoken with him.  
14 
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
And Jacob setteth up a standing pillar in the place where He hath spoken with him, a standing pillar of stone, and he poureth on it an oblation, and he poureth on it oil;  
15 
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
and Jacob calleth the name of the place where God spake with him Bethel.  
16 
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
And they journey from Bethel, and there is yet a kibrath of land before entering Ephratha, and Rachel beareth, and is sharply pained in her bearing;  
17 
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
and it cometh to pass, in her being sharply pained in her bearing, that the midwife saith to her, `Fear not, for this also `is' a son for thee.' 
18 
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
And it cometh to pass in the going out of her soul (for she died), that she calleth his name Ben-Oni; and his father called him Benjamin;  
19 
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
and Rachel dieth, and is buried in the way to Ephratha, which `is' Bethlehem, 
20 
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
and Jacob setteth up a standing pillar over her grave; which `is' the standing pillar of Rachel's grave unto this day. 
21 
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
And Israel journeyeth, and stretcheth out his tent beyond the tower of Edar;  
22 
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
and it cometh to pass in Israel's dwelling in that land, that Reuben goeth, and lieth with Bilhah his father's concubine; and Israel heareth.  
23 
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
And the sons of Jacob are twelve. Sons of Leah: Jacob's first-born Reuben, and Simeon, and Levi, and Judah, and Issachar, and Zebulun.  
24 
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
Sons of Rachel: Joseph and Benjamin.  
25 
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
And sons of Bilhah, Rachel's maid-servant: Dan and Naphtali.  
26 
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
And sons of Zilpah, Leah's maid-servant: Gad and Asher. These `are' sons of Jacob, who have been born to him in Padan-Aram. 
27 
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
And Jacob cometh unto Isaac his father, at Mamre, the city of Arba (which `is' Hebron), where Abraham and Isaac have sojourned. 
28 
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
And the days of Isaac are a hundred and eighty years,  
29 
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
fjrigjwwe9r2Younhs_EN_Bible:TextData
and Isaac expireth, and dieth, and is gathered unto his people, aged and satisfied with days; and bury him do Esau and Jacob his sons.
